What is EnumeratorConnectivity

EnumeratorConnectivity is an adware application that targets Mac computers. Adware’s basic purpose is to display advertisements. These advertisements are often presented as sponsored links, fake alerts, push notifications, unclosable windows or different offers and deals. Clicks on the ads produce a monetary payoff for the adware authors. Adware can work like Spyware, since it sends personal data such as searches and trends to advertisers.

How does EnumeratorConnectivity get on your MAC OS

Adware can be spread through the use of trojan horses and other forms of malware, but in most cases, adware is bundled with some freeware. Many developers of free applications include optional software in their installation package. Sometimes it’s possible to avoid the setup of any adware: carefully read the Terms of Use and the Software license, select only Manual, Custom or Advanced install method, disable all checkboxes before clicking Install or Next button while installing new free software.

Remove profiles created by EnumeratorConnectivity

EnumeratorConnectivity can install a configuration profile on the Mac system to block changes made to the browser settings. Therefore, you need to open system preferences, find and delete the profile installed by the adware.

Click the System Preferences icon ( ) in the Dock, or choose Apple menu ( ) > System Preferences.

In System Preferences, click Profiles, then select a profile associated with EnumeratorConnectivity.

Click the minus button ( – ) located at the bottom-left of the Profiles screen to remove the profile.
Note: if you do not see Profiles in the System Preferences, that means there are no profiles installed on your Mac computer, which is normal.

Remove EnumeratorConnectivity related files and folders

Now you need to try to find EnumeratorConnectivity related files and folders, and then delete them manually. You need to look for these files in certain directories. To quickly open them, we recommend using the “Go to Folder…” command.

EnumeratorConnectivity creates several files, these files must be found and removed. Below is a list of files associated with this unwanted program.

  • /Library/LaunchDaemons/com.EnumeratorConnectivity.system.plist
  • ~/Library/LaunchAgents/com.EnumeratorConnectivity.service.plist
  • /Library/Application Support/.(RANDOM)/System/com.EnumeratorConnectivity.system
  • ~/Library/Application Support/.(RANDOM)/Services/com.EnumeratorConnectivity.service.app

Some files created by EnumeratorConnectivity are hidden from the user. To find and delete them, you need to enable “show hidden files”. To do this, use the shortcut CMD + SHIFT + . Press once to show hidden files and again to hide them. There is another way. Click Finder -> Applications -> Utilities -> Terminal. In Terminal, paste the following text: defaults write com.apple.finder AppleShowAllFiles YES

show hidden files

Press Enter. Hold the ‘Option/alt’ key, then right click on the Finder icon in the dock and click Relaunch.

relaunch finder

Click on the Finder icon. From the menu bar, select Go and click “Go to Folder…”. As a result, a small window opens that allows you to quickly open a specific directory.

mac go to folder

Check for EnumeratorConnectivity generated files in the /Library/LaunchAgents folder

open LaunchAgents folder

In the “Go to Folder…” window, type the following text and press Go:
/Library/LaunchAgents

LaunchAgents folder

This will open the contents of the “/Library/LaunchAgents” folder. Look carefully at it and pay special attention to recently created files, as well as files that have a suspicious name. Move all suspicious files to the Trash. A few examples of files: macsearch.plist, search.plist, com.net-preferences.plist, com.machelper.plist, com.google.defaultsearch.plist, , installapp.plist and com.EnumeratorConnectivity.service.plist. Most often, browser hijackers, potentially unwanted programs and adware software create several files with similar names.

Check for EnumeratorConnectivity generated files in the /Library/Application Support folder

open Application Support folder

In the “Go to Folder…” window, type the following text and press Go:
/Library/Application Support

Application Support folder

This will open the contents of the “Application Support” folder. Look carefully at its contents, pay special attention to recently added/changed folders and files. Check the contents of suspicious folders, if there is a file with a name similar to com.EnumeratorConnectivity.system, then this folder must be deleted. Move all suspicious folders and files to the Trash.

Check for EnumeratorConnectivity generated files in the “~/Library/LaunchAgents” folder

open LaunchAgents

In the “Go to Folder…” window, type the following text and press Go:
~/Library/LaunchAgents

~/Library/LaunchAgents folder

Proceed in the same way as with the “/Library/LaunchAgents” and “/Library/Application Support” folders. Look for suspicious and recently added files. Move all suspicious files to the Trash.

Check for EnumeratorConnectivity generated files in the /Library/LaunchDaemons folder

In the “Go to Folder…” window, type the following text and press Go:
/Library/LaunchDaemons

LaunchDaemons folder

Carefully browse the entire list of files and pay special attention to recently created files, as well as files that have a suspicious name. Move all suspicious files to the Trash. A few examples of files to be deleted: com.machelper.system.plist, com.installapp.system.plist, com.macsearch.system.plist, com.search.system.plist and com.EnumeratorConnectivity.system.plist. In most cases, browser hijackers, PUPs and adware create several files with similar names.
